Re: My Mac needs help, I can't launch TT.
This sounds like a problem that first appeared when Mac released 10.4
I'm guessing that you recently upgraded from 10.3 to 10.4?
If the game crashes when you mouse over a button, it probably is this problem. The sound that should play when you move over a button crashes TT. It's because of how the sound is handled by the game.
One fix is to download a current version of TT from GarageGames. (But, this works only if you bought it from GG) To get that version you have to log into your GarageGames account and download a new copy. The new copy has the fix built in.

I'm guessing that you recently upgraded from 10.3 to 10.4?
If the game crashes when you mouse over a button, it probably is this problem. The sound that should play when you move over a button crashes TT. It's because of how the sound is handled by the game.
One fix is to download a current version of TT from GarageGames. (But, this works only if you bought it from GG) To get that version you have to log into your GarageGames account and download a new copy. The new copy has the fix built in.
The other fix I know is to download a new OpenAL package and install it. (This is from an old thread on PTT)
http://supra.planetthinktanks2.com/arch ... 230799.asp
1. Download and install this package: http://homepage.mac.com/mdisabato/.cv/m ... kg-zip.zip
2. Follow this path through your computer: HardDrive/System/Library/Frameworks. There you will find the old OpenAL. Throw that one in the trash. (you will need the administrator password for this).
3.After the new package is instaled, you will find it through this path: HardDrive/Library/Frameworks. Take that and put it in the old ones place. It will ask you something and press the button that is beside cancel. It will need the password again.
After I did this, it worked!
That's how I fixed my copy, but once GarageGames released an update, I installed that newer version.
